在当今移动互联网飞速发展的时代,手机网页制作已经成为网站开发的核心任务之一。作为一名长期耕耘于网页编辑行业的从业者,我深刻体会到HTML在手机网页实现中的基础性和关键性作用。HTML(超文本标记语言)作为构建网页的骨架,其直接决定了网页的结构、兼容性和用户体验。当面对手机屏幕的多样化尺寸和网络环境的波动时,HTML的实现技巧就显得尤为重要。接下来,我将基于实际操作经验,分享一些实用的HTML实现方法,帮助开发者优化手机网页的制作过程。
首先,响应式设计是手机网页制作的基石。手机屏幕从3.5英寸到6.7英寸不等,如果网页不能自适应,用户体验就会大打折扣。在HTML中,实现响应式的第一步是正确设置视口标签。这在HTML头部添加<meta name="viewport" content="width=device-width, initial-scale=1.0;">至关重要。这个标签告诉浏览器如何渲染页面,确保内容在移动设备上正确缩放。例如,在开发一个电商网站时,如果不设置视口,商品图片和导航栏可能会在小屏幕上显示不全或缩放失真。实践中,我发现添加这个标签后,页面能自动适应不同设备,减少滚动条的干扰,提升整体观感。此外,结合媒体查询(CSS的一部分,但与HTML结构紧密结合)可以进一步优化布局。比如,在HTML中预留多个区块,然后通过CSS针对不同屏幕尺寸调整宽度,像@media (max-width: 600px) { .container { width: 100%; } }这样的规则,能让手机用户获得流畅的浏览体验。响应式设计不仅提升用户体验,还能降低维护成本,因为一套HTML代码可以覆盖多种设备。
其次,语义化HTML标签的使用能显著增强手机网页的可读性和可访问性。现代HTML5提供了丰富的语义化标签,如<header>、<footer>、<nav>、<section>和<article>,这些标签不仅让代码更清晰,还能帮助搜索引擎优化和辅助技术(如屏幕阅读器)更好地解析内容。在实际项目中,我曾为一个新闻网站改造HTML结构,将原来的<div>替换为语义化标签。例如,导航栏改用<nav>包裹,文章主体改用<article>,底部信息改用<footer>。这样修改后,页面结构一目了然,手机用户在快速浏览时能更容易识别关键区域。更重要的是,语义化HTML有助于减少代码冗余,提升加载速度。手机用户通常依赖移动数据网络,页面加载慢会导致跳出率上升。通过语义化标签,开发者可以精简代码,避免不必要的嵌套,从而实现更快的渲染。例如,一个简单的手机导航菜单可以这样写:
<nav>
<ul>
<li><a href="/">首页</a></li>
<li><a href="/about">关于我们</a></li>
<li><a href="/contact">联系方式</a></li>
</ul>
</nav>
这种简洁的结构不仅易于维护,还能让搜索引擎更容易索引,从而提升网站在手机搜索结果中的排名。
第三,性能优化是手机网页制作中不可忽视的环节。HTML代码的效率直接影响页面加载时间和流量消耗。在手机环境中,用户往往需要快速获取信息,因此优化HTML以减少文件大小和提高加载速度是关键。实际操作中,我推荐使用HTML压缩工具来移除不必要的空格、注释和冗余标签。例如,将注释<!-- 这是一个注释 -->删除,或合并重复的样式标签,能显著减少代码体积。同时,利用延迟加载技术(如loading="lazy"属性)优化图片和媒体资源,避免一次性加载所有内容。在HTML中,可以这样实现:
<img src="image.jpg" alt="产品图片" loading="lazy">
这样,只有当图片滚动到视口时才会加载,节省带宽和加载时间。另一个实用技巧是减少HTTP请求数量,通过内联关键CSS或合并脚本。在开发一个博客网站时,我发现将常用的CSS样式直接嵌入HTML头部,能加快首屏渲染速度。例如:
<head>
<style>
body { font-family: Arial, sans-serif; }
.post { margin-bottom: 20px; }
</style>
</head>
此外,使用CDN(内容分发网络)托管外部资源,如HTML或脚本文件,也能提升加载效率。性能优化不仅能提升用户体验,还能降低服务器负载,特别是在访问量高峰期,确保手机网页的稳定性。
最后,实战中的最佳实践和工具运用能让HTML手机网页制作更高效。在编辑过程中,我始终强调模块化和可维护性。通过HTML模板(如使用<template>标签)或组件化思路,开发者可以重复利用代码块。例如,创建一个可重用的页脚组件:
<footer>
<p>© 2023 我的公司</p>
<a href="/privacy">隐私政策</a>
</footer>
这种模块化方式减少了重复劳动,提高了开发效率。在实际项目中,我发现结合版本控制系统(如Git)管理HTML文件,能更轻松地追踪变更和回滚错误。至于工具,开发者可以使用浏览器开发者工具(如Chrome DevTools)实时调试HTML结构,模拟手机环境测试响应式效果。同时,在线资源如W3Schools或MDN Web Docs提供了丰富的HTML文档,帮助新手快速学习。但要注意,这些工具只是辅助,核心还是在于理解和应用HTML的基本原理。通过持续实践,比如参与开源项目或构建个人手机网页,开发者能不断积累经验,打造出既美观又高效的移动端页面。
总之,手机网页制作的HTML实现技巧涵盖了响应式设计、语义化标签、性能优化和最佳实践等多个方面。这些方法不仅提升了网页的兼容性和用户体验,还赋予了开发者更高的灵活性和效率。在实际工作中,结合具体项目需求选择合适的策略,不断测试和迭代,才能制作出真正优秀的手机网页。移动互联网的未来充满挑战,但掌握HTML的核心技巧,就能让网站在手机屏幕上绽放光彩。